H.R. No. 2084
 
 
 
R E S O L U T I O N
 
         WHEREAS, Scooter Fries is being inducted into the Texas
  Heroes Hall of Honor at the Frontier Times Museum in Bandera on July
  23, 2011, the National Day of the American Cowboy; and
         WHEREAS, Founded in 1933, the museum houses the Western
  memorabilia collection of J. Marvin Hunter, the publisher of
  Frontier Times magazine; this year's Hall of Honor ceremony
  recognizes the pioneering spirit, strength of character, and
  contributions to Texas culture of one posthumous inductee and four
  living legends; and
         WHEREAS, Scooter Fries was a child prodigy roper who began
  performing exhibitions of his skill throughout South Texas at the
  age of eight; he was already a veteran of the sport by the time he
  won the Texas Junior State Roping Championship in 1948; he went on
  to win two more state championships, as well as both the 1950 and
  1951 national championships; and
         WHEREAS, Following his career, Mr. Fries helped to establish
  the Cowboy Capital Rodeo Association in Bandera; the organization
  hosts an annual PRCA Pro Rodeo and sponsors rodeo performances for
  schools throughout the area; and
         WHEREAS, The achievements of Scooter Fries have greatly
  enhanced the richness and diversity of Texas culture, and he may
  indeed take pride in this special recognition from the Frontier
  Times Museum; now, therefore, be it
         RESOLVED, That the House of Representatives of the 82nd Texas
  Legislature hereby congratulate Scooter Fries on his induction into
  the Frontier Times Museum Texas Heroes Hall of Honor and commend him
  for his enduring contributions to the Lone Star State; and, be it
  further
         RESOLVED, That an official copy of this resolution be
  prepared for Mr. Fries as an expression of high regard by the Texas
  House of Representatives.
